Job Overview
The Project Operations Coordinator plays a vital role in ensuring the seamless execution of project-related sales orders and logistics. This position manages the entire sales order lifecycle, from entry and revision in the ERP system to shipment coordination and return material authorization (RMA) processing. The coordinator works closely with internal teams such as Sales, Planning, Engineering, Projects, Controls, and Warehouse, as well as external customers and logistics providers, to ensure timely delivery and customer satisfaction. This role requires str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and excellent communication abilities.
 
Key Responsibilities
 
  • Accurately enter sales orders into the ERP system and submit for approval.
  • Manage and process sales order revisions and updates as necessary.
  • Maintain accurate, up-to-date sales order data in the ERP system.
  • Oversee and track past-due shipments, proactively addressing potential delays.
  • Create shipping documents and manage the shipping process.
  • Notify customers of parts readiness for pickup or shipment.
  • Generate shipment reports to track progress and identify potential issues.
  • Coordinate crating requests with external vendors.
  • Verify weights and dimensions with the warehouse team to ensure accuracy in packing lists and commercial invoices.
  • Edit and finalize packing lists and commercial invoices.
  • Conduct End-User Certificate (EUC) checks for internal company orders to ensure compliance with export regulations.
  • Serve as the primary point of contact for customers and logistics providers, providing timely updates and resolving inquiries or issues.
  • Manage the RMA process, including receiving, processing, and tracking returned materials.
